The substance is the skeletal deposits of Lithothamnion … WebJan 1, 2013 · Calcified red algae include corallines that are marine, calcitic, occur at all latitudes, and are important reef builders. In contrast, calcified marine green dasycladaleans and halimedaceans are aragonitic and mainly tropical. They mainly produce particulate sediment, although Halimeda creates reefs with its disarticulated segments.
